TREE NEWS reports: UK retail sales showed modest growth in August, with BRC like-for-like sales rising 0.5% year-on-year, down from 1% in the previous month. The data indicates a slowdown in consumer spending amid ongoing economic pressures.
UK August BRC like-for-like sales up 0.5% YoY
